Resonance Compensation. Klipper supports Input Shaping - a technique that can be used to reduce ringing (also known as echoing, ghosting or rippling) in prints. Ringing is a surface printing defect when, typically, elements like edges repeat themselves on a printed surface as a subtle 'echo': | | |. I used the Klipper config from BTT E3 ...Marlin's latest firmwares use a "no-overshoot" version of the PID tuning algorithm. It's easy to convert Klipper's traditional PID values to the no-overshoot equivalent. After doing a PID tune in Klipper, divide Kp by 3, divide Ki by 3, and multiply Kd by 0.88. I followed this procedure to fins out IP and updated conf file.First determine the type of belt. Most printers use a 2mm belt pitch (that is, each tooth on the belt is 2mm apart). Then count the number of teeth on the stepper motor pulley. The rotation_distance is then calculated as: rotation_distance = <belt_pitch> * <number_of_teeth_on_pulley>. See the installation document for information on setting up Klipper and choosing an initial config file.The above TUNING_TOWER command instructs Klipper to alter the pressure_advance setting on each layer of the print. Higher layers in the print will have a larger pressure advance value set. Sensorless homing allows to home an axis without the need for a physical limit switch. Instead, the carriage on the axis is moved into the mechanical limit making the stepper motor lose steps.
